Transaction d81204209f508d604cd0cfefb7ac31493cc96b8f107f4d6aa910edb18140cf98

1 Input
1 Outputs
  • d81204209f508d604cd0cfefb7ac31493cc96b8f107f4d6aa910edb18140cf98:0
  • value  2500000000
    address  muE7BXCc92fNNZ8KW5eDDQLVCMkVsf4wuq